Emotional Turning Points in Casey and Brett Story
The core dynamic between Casey and Brett hinges on vulnerability. Early interactions mask deeper fears, and each confrontation reveals new layers of their attachment styles, shaping how they approach closeness and separation.
Season 2 emphasizes quiet, everyday choices rather than grand gestures. Small acts of consistency, like showing up after work or remembering important details, signal reliability and gradually mend the rift created by past misunderstandings.
Season 3 uses family stress as a narrative device to accelerate emotional maturity. Both characters are forced to communicate under pressure, which allows suppressed feelings to surface and gives their reconciliation a more substantial foundation than before.
Character Growth Driving Reunion Decisions
Casey learns to voice needs instead of withdrawing, which reduces misinterpretation and builds mutual respect. This shift is critical when evaluating whether their moments back together stem from genuine compatibility or temporary emotional dependency.
Brett confronts commitment anxiety by actively choosing partnership over avoidance. Their willingness to set boundaries and renegotiate expectations reflects growth and supports a healthier, more sustainable relationship moving forward.
